Chapter 7 Maintenance — Warning displays
Warning displays
The following warnings are displayed if problems are detected during operation.
Camera warning displays
r
When AWB (automatic white balance) is executed
[AWB HIGH LIGHT NG]
Automatic white balance cannot be executed because the light amount is excessive.
Set the light amount to an appropriate level.
[AWB LOW LIGHT NG]
Automatic white balance cannot be executed because the light amount is insufficient.
Set the light amount to an appropriate level.
[AWB RCH OUT RANGE]
The white balance convergence for red cannot be achieved.
Shoot a uniformly white object on the screen, and execute AWB.
[AWB BCH OUT RANGE]
The white balance convergence for blue cannot be achieved.
Shoot a uniformly white object on the screen, and execute AWB.
r
When ABB (automatic black balance) is executed
[ABB RCH OUT RANGE]
The black balance convergence for red cannot be achieved.
Check if there are any errors in the image.
[ABB BCH OUT RANGE]
The black balance convergence for blue cannot be achieved.
Check if there are any errors in the image.
[ABB GCH OUT RANGE]
The black balance convergence for green cannot be achieved.
Check if there are any errors in the image.
[ABB NG]
It is possible that the light has not been shut out, with a lens cap not attached.
r
Executing black shading
[BSHD NG]
Attach a lens cap and confirm that light has been properly shut out.
Other warning displays
The IPU <ALARM> lamp lights red while the warnings are being displayed.
Excluding the [CABLE OPEN] warning, the front tally lamp and back tally lamp of the camera both blink red when there is a warning.
[FAN NG]
There is a problem in the fan.
[HIGH TEMPERATURE]
The internal temperature is high.
[LOW VOLTAGE]
The voltage of the external DC power supply is low.
[SHUTDOWN SOON]
The internal temperature is rising more than expected. Or, the voltage of the external DC power supply has lowered
beyond the operation guarantee.
The power is turned off forcefully in 30 seconds.
[CABLE OPEN]
An optical fiber cable has not been connected, or the camera is not being supplied with power.
